Output 05af750033cda6f6a6ba74ae64ba850bb3fa33bbd724c191908e13b998dedb2d:0

value
140440
script pubkey
OP_0 OP_PUSHBYTES_20 c489a573000f565fc7d12c5e112118ba415b8b4a
address
bc1qcjy62ucqpat9l373930pzggchfq4hz62emwqxk
transaction
05af750033cda6f6a6ba74ae64ba850bb3fa33bbd724c191908e13b998dedb2d
confirmations
592
spent
false